The Signs Your Pipes May Need Relining

If you’re uncertain whether or not your pipes require relining, here’s the signs to watch for:

  • Water leakage
  • Odors coming from your drains
  • Gurgling noises coming from your drains
  • Slow drainage or clogs

Should I Get My Pipes Relined or Replaced?

This is a question many homeowners have to have to ask at time. Both replacement and relining come with their advantages and disadvantages, which is why it can be difficult to determine what is best for you. Here are a few concerns to take into consideration:

Relining

  • Relining is cheaper than replacing.
  • It is possible to do it without having to tear out the floor or walls.
  • It is feasible to do it fast generally in a day or two.
  • There is less of a mess to clean up after the job is finished.
  • The new liner will last for many years.

Replacement

  • Repairs are more expensive than Relining.
  • It’s an unpleasant job as well, and you may need to vacate home house for a few days as it is being done.
  • The new pipe is expected to last for many years.

The Pipe Relining Strategy

In the past, if you wanted to mend a pipe, you needed to dig. It was laborious, dirty and costly operation.

Today, thanks to pipe relining, also known as trenchless pipelining or trenchless sewer repair, we’re able to skip all of that. Simply put, pipe relining Kinross is the job process of inserting new pipes inside older ones.

The days of digging into the yard, banging, and causing structural damage to your house are over. If your pipe is leaking, you can line it by relining it. The pipe can be lined if it is structurally sound.

We offer the following simple, mess-free process:

  • We Investigate
  • We Clear
  • We Reline
  • We Cure & Cut
  • We Clean

Is It Possible To Reline Pipes That Have Bends In Them?

The trenchless pipe relining process is a fantastic no dig method of fixing broken pipes with bends within them. The process of pipe relining makes an entirely new pipe inside an existing pipeline. This means that you don’t need to take out the old pipe and can replace it without having to dig into your driveway or yard.

The difficulty of a pipe relining project increases with more bends within the pipe. Our team of experts has lined many sewer lines that have bends.

While this is challenging, it is not impossible and we’ve got the experience and knowledge to get the job completed right.

Can Collapsed Pipes Be Relined?

We are not able to reline pipes that have collapsed. If you have a collapsed pipe and it has a leak, you’ll require replacing the pipe in its entirety. If you’re not sure the extent of damage to your pipe We can visit to conduct an inspection for you.

What Is The Difference Between Pipe Replacement And Pipe Relining?

Pipe relining makes a new pipe inside an old one, while pipe burst is a process that breaks the old pipe and replaces it with the new one.

Pipe relining is generally less invasive and can be a more cost-effective option than pipe replacement. Talk to a specialist about your specific needs to see what option will work best for you.

Does Pipe Relining Reduce The Pipe Flow?

There is rarely a decrease in pipe flow due to pipe relining. Relining pipes is often a way to increase your flow through the pipe since it creates a new, smooth surface for water through.

How Long Has Pipe Relining Been An Option?

Pipe relining has been in use for quite a while, beginning with the first recorded instance occurring in 1854. It was not until the 2000s that it was beginning to become more commonplace.

Today, pipe relining technology is widely used around the globe as a successful solution to fix damaged or leaking pipes without having to dig them up to replace them entirely. There are numerous types of pipe relining services that can be used in accordance with the type of pipe as well as the severity of what the issue is.

For example, there is spot pipe relining Kinross, which is used to fix small leaks in addition to structural pipe liner, which is used for more severe damage. Whichever type of pipe relining is utilised it’s the goal is always the same: to repair the pipe without replacing it entirely.

This no dig option could save you time and money in addition, it’s also a more environmentally friendly option than replacing the pipe.
